MONACO, Monaco - Defending world rally champion Sebastien Ogier of France began his title defence with a victory at the season-opening Monte Carlo rally Sunday, finishing ahead of Finlands Jari-Matti Latvala and Andreas Mikkelsen of Norway as Volkswagen swept the podium places.Ogier led Latvala by 42.8 seconds overnight and increased his lead after Sundays three stages to finish 58 seconds ahead of Latvala and more than two minutes clear of Mikkelsen.Winning Monte Carlo means a lot for every driver, but especially for me, Ogier said after clinching it for the third time. This event had the best atmosphere I have experienced on a rally. When I drove the stage close to my home village, the atmosphere was magical.The 31-year-old Ogier was only interested in protecting his lead and drove cautiously, failing to win a stage Saturday or Sunday.The important thing is to try to win the rally, not todays stages, he said. Its the most important rally of the season. The weather makes it a huge challenge but the satisfaction is great when you make it.Citroen driver Mads Ostberg of Norway finished fourth.Retired nine-time champion Sebastien Loeb of France — driving as a guest at the race — won Sundays penultimate stage and finished eighth overall.Britains Kris Meeke won Sundays opener — a short 10-kilometre (6-mile) trek — with Ogier finishing sixth and gaining a further five seconds on Latvala, who was ninth.Ogier again placed fifth on the next special — stage 14 from La Bollene Vesubie to Sospel — and finished more than 10 seconds clear of Latvala.Stage 14 featured the races famed hairpin ascent up Col de Turini, and Polish driver Robert Kubica, the winner of four stages, had to pull out as he went off the road at the finish.Latvala also had problems negotiating Turinis flying finish.The brakes are horrible, he said. I had no bite on them and it was very, very scary to drive.Loeb, a seven-time winner at Monaco, won the stage ahead of Ostberg.Meeke clinched stage 15 — a special power stage — to take maximum bonus points, with Loeb taking two bonus points for second spot and Latvala taking one for third.The next event is at Rally Sweden next month. Heidi Weng of Norway took bronze.Allen Park, MI - The Detroit Lions placed defensive tackle C.J. Mosley back on the active roster after he completed serving a club-issued two-week suspension for conduct detrimental to the team. The Lions sent Mosley home during their recent trip to London for an undisclosed violation of team rules, which ESPN later reporting that the 10- year veteran was caught with marijuana in his hotel room and had disabled a smoke detector. Mosleys reinstatement was one of several roster moves the Lions made following their bye week. In addition, Detroit activated rookie linebacker Kyle Van Noy from injured reserve/designated to return and brought back deefensive tackle Andre Fluellen while releasing cornerback Danny Gorrer.dddddddddddd Van Noy, the Lions second-round pick of the 2014 draft, underwent surgery just prior to the start of the season to repair a core muscle injury. Head coach Jim Caldwell said Monday that the BYU product is expected to make his NFL debut in Sundays game against Miami. Fluellen, who played in 13 games with Detroit last year and has spent parts of each of the previous six seasons as a member of the Lions, was re-signed with defensive tackle Nick Fairley out indefinitely with a knee injury he sustained in the teams Oct. 26 win over Atlanta in London.
